Package io.dapr.v1
Interface DaprProtos.SubtleEncryptRequestOrBuilder
-
- All Superinterfaces:
com.google.protobuf.MessageLiteOrBuilder
,com.google.protobuf.MessageOrBuilder
- All Known Implementing Classes:
DaprProtos.SubtleEncryptRequest
,DaprProtos.SubtleEncryptRequest.Builder
- Enclosing class:
- DaprProtos
public static interface DaprProtos.SubtleEncryptRequestOrBuilder extends com.google.protobuf.MessageOrBuilder
-
-
Method Summary
All Methods Instance Methods Abstract Methods Modifier and Type Method Description String
getAlgorithm()
Algorithm to use, as in the JWA standard.com.google.protobuf.ByteString
getAlgorithmBytes()
Algorithm to use, as in the JWA standard.com.google.protobuf.ByteString
getAssociatedData()
Associated Data when using AEAD ciphers (optional).String
getComponentName()
Name of the componentcom.google.protobuf.ByteString
getComponentNameBytes()
Name of the componentString
getKeyName()
Name (or name/version) of the key.com.google.protobuf.ByteString
getKeyNameBytes()
Name (or name/version) of the key.com.google.protobuf.ByteString
getNonce()
Nonce / initialization vector.com.google.protobuf.ByteString
getPlaintext()
Message to encrypt.-
Methods inherited from interface com.google.protobuf.MessageOrBuilder
findInitializationErrors, getAllFields, getDefaultInstanceForType, getDescriptorForType, getField, getInitializationErrorString, getOneofFieldDescriptor, getRepeatedField, getRepeatedFieldCount, getUnknownFields, hasField, hasOneof
-
-
-
-
Method Detail
-
getComponentName
String getComponentName()
Name of the component
string component_name = 1 [json_name = "componentName"];
- Returns:
- The componentName.
-
getComponentNameBytes
com.google.protobuf.ByteString getComponentNameBytes()
Name of the component
string component_name = 1 [json_name = "componentName"];
- Returns:
- The bytes for componentName.
-
getPlaintext
com.google.protobuf.ByteString getPlaintext()
Message to encrypt.
bytes plaintext = 2;
- Returns:
- The plaintext.
-
getAlgorithm
String getAlgorithm()
Algorithm to use, as in the JWA standard.
string algorithm = 3;
- Returns:
- The algorithm.
-
getAlgorithmBytes
com.google.protobuf.ByteString getAlgorithmBytes()
Algorithm to use, as in the JWA standard.
string algorithm = 3;
- Returns:
- The bytes for algorithm.
-
getKeyName
String getKeyName()
Name (or name/version) of the key.
string key_name = 4 [json_name = "keyName"];
- Returns:
- The keyName.
-
getKeyNameBytes
com.google.protobuf.ByteString getKeyNameBytes()
Name (or name/version) of the key.
string key_name = 4 [json_name = "keyName"];
- Returns:
- The bytes for keyName.
-
getNonce
com.google.protobuf.ByteString getNonce()
Nonce / initialization vector. Ignored with asymmetric ciphers.
bytes nonce = 5;
- Returns:
- The nonce.
-
getAssociatedData
com.google.protobuf.ByteString getAssociatedData()
Associated Data when using AEAD ciphers (optional).
bytes associated_data = 6 [json_name = "associatedData"];
- Returns:
- The associatedData.
-
-